MediaTek announced a higher-end chipset, Helio P25, that will debut in Q1 2017. Here's the detail!

MediaTek Helio P25 Supports Dual-Lens Module

The Taiwanese chipmaker introduced the latest processor on Wednesday with highlights including dual-lens camera support. Helio P25 is manufactured on 16nm process - enabling it to save more power.

Helio P25 has a higher clock than its predecessor and according to the company, it is able to support either a single 24 MP camera or dual 13 MP camera.

Along with the optics, it supports features like HDR video and Bokeh effect, as reported in GSM Arena. A handset sporting Helio P25 will be able to capture great images with lesser noise and improved resolution.

MediaTek Helio P25 Specs

MediaTek's processor is not only good for dual-lens camera but it can support a massive RAM up to 6 gigs. Furthermore, it supports ARM Mali T880 dual GPU with 900 MHz base clock. Performance-wise, the chip has an enhanced visual experience that makes it capable of playing VR games especially with its multimedia features.

It's uncertain as to which smartphones will be using the chip since this is a huge leap from its previous chips. MediaTek is popular among entry-level performers, according to Phone Arena, and this could be a big step that allows the company to embark to European market and meet its direct rival, Exynos.

There have been a few budget handsets carrying MediaTek processor, such as, Xiaomi Redmi Note 3, Sony Xperia C4, HTC One M9+, and Vivo X5 Max Platinum Edition. The premium chip is expected to be integrated with a wider range of smartphones in the future.
